A TV show had 4.4 x 10^6 viewers in the first week and 3.1 x 10^6 viewers in the second week. Determine the average number of viewers over the two weeks and write the final answer in scientific notation.
a) 3.75 x 10^12
b) 3.75 x 10^6
c) 7.5 x 10^12
d) 7.5 x 10^6

To find the average number of viewers over the two weeks, you need to add the total number of viewers for both weeks and then divide by two.
Total number of viewers = 4.4 x 10^6 + 3.1 x 10^6 = 7.5 x 10^6
Average number of viewers = (7.5 x 10^6) / 2 = 3.75 x 10^6
Therefore, the final answer in scientific notation is:
b) 3.75 x 10^6
